‘Never Hike With AirPods’: Volume up to Hear This Hiker’s Reason

Ted Zimnicki is encouraging hikers to leave their AirPods and other headphones at home while hiking this spring. Why? Because, sometimes, you need to hear what’s going on around the trail. Zimnicki experienced this first hand on a recent hike, when he suddenly heard a rattlesnake rattling just off trail. He reacted immediately to the sound, backing up and moving away from the spot where he heard the snake.

“Wait for it . . .” wrote Zimnicki in an Instagram post sharing footage of the startling moment. His video is also overlaid with the text, “We never hike with AirPods.”

In rattlesnake country, Zimnicki’s precautionary tale is an important reminder to other hikers to keep an eye (and an ear) out for this specific danger near trails.
